Invesco S&P MidCap 400 Revenue ETF (NYSEARCA:RWK) Sees Large Growth in Short Interest

Invesco S&P MidCap 400 Revenue ETF (NYSEARCA:RWKGet Free Report) was the recipient of a large growth in short interest during the month of July. As of July 15th, there was short interest totaling 60,297 shares, a growth of 242.3% from the June 30th total of 17,614 shares. Currently, 0.7% of the company’s shares are short sold. Based on an average daily volume of 16,303 shares, the days-to-cover ratio is presently 3.7 days.

Invesco S&P MidCap 400 Revenue ETF Company Profile

RevenueShares Mid Cap ETF (the Fund) seeks to achieve its investment objective of outperforming the total return performance of the S&P MidCap 400 Index (S&P 400) by investing in the constituent securities of the S&P 400 in the same proportions as the RevenueShares Mid Cap Index. The Fund consists of the same constituent securities as the S&P 400. But rather than being weighted by market capitalization, the Fund employs a patent-pending investment methodology to weight stocks by annual revenue. The Fund is rebalanced annually.
